Drinking alcohol while taking certain medications could make you drowsy, and lightheaded and put you at risk for dangerous driving. drinking alcohol can weaken your body’s ability to fight off infection. we should also avoid alcohol when we are sick, as it can have harmful interactions with multiple ingredients found in cold and flu medications.
